Episode 7 of ‘The Power of Better’ features the construction of Homewood Brewing Company, a tribute to the late rapper Juice WRLD

 

The Power of Better episode 7 offers an exclusive behind-the-scenes look at a special project underway in Homewood, Illinois – the construction of Homewood Brewing Company, a new restaurant and brewery honoring the beloved rapper Juice WRLD, who tragically passed away four years ago at only 21 years old. 

“Even after he became famous, he always ran back to Homewood. You know, he always felt safe at home. So it just seemed like the right place to be,” Carmella Wallace, mother of the late artist recalled.

To execute the buildout, experienced construction partners were brought in. As the general contractor, Crosstown Design Build was responsible for managing and executing the overall construction. They worked closely with Carmella Wallace on design details like layout, customer flow, aesthetics, and optimal building placement to bring the vision to life.

To achieve the ambitious vision of brewing exceptional beer with unparalleled consistency, Brian Wallace, Juice WRLD’s brother, brought on master brewer Kam Horn. Applying his German brewing techniques expertise, Horn fine-tuned the state-of-the-art brewery system to enable precise control of the brewing process. 

“You want that beer to taste exactly the same when you come back months later and share it with friends,” Horn explained. “This advanced system lets me perfectly calibrate each batch, so customers enjoy the same incredible beer every single visit.” 

By leveraging the technology, Horn could ensure every pint delivers a superb, consistent brewing experience.

The brewery required advanced systems where Powering Chicago member contractor Linear Electric provided invaluable expertise. 

“Our workers bring high technical skills from our apprenticeship school, and have had one of the finest upbringings in the industry,” Bob Fimbianti, Owner of Linear Electric, said.

Linear Electric played a critical role making the brewery vision a reality by handling the motor control center installation. This centralized system coordinates all brewing processes. By flawlessly implementing it, Linear Electric enabled oversight and automation for streamlined, consistent production. The system allows precise calibration by master brewer Kam Horn so customers enjoy the same incredible beer every visit. Linear Electric’s execution provided advanced infrastructure to meet Brian Wallace’s exceptional consistency vision.
